Google+-iOSLast night, Google released a new version of Google+ that features a heavy dose of photo features. In addition to photo upgrades, the new app will include hashtag support, ability to update profile and cover photos and the addition of Google Offers in the stream. The new app is also now sans Hangouts as the popular messaging service is now a standalone app.

The handful of photo changes include auto-enhancements, better organization and support of animations and panoramas. The Auto Enhance feature allows users to quickly touch up photos right from the app, while Auto Highlight will select the best photo from a series of photos uploaded. An Auto Awesome feature combines multiple into one, and Auto Backup will send all photos to Google+ for safe keeping.

The full list of changes shown in the App Store include:

– What’s New in Version 4.4.0
– New Google+ Photos features keep photos organized and looking their best
– Make your photos look even better with Auto Enhance
– Browse highlights from all your photos
– Share short animations, panoramas, and more
– Hangouts has moved to its own app for messaging and video calls
– Discover interesting content via related hashtags
– Ability to edit more profile fields and upload a cover photo
– New interactive Google Offer posts in the stream
– Control how often What’s Hot posts appear in your stream
– Support for displaying strikethrough text
– Ability to edit comments
– Ability to copy the post’s permalink

Those who’ve relied on Hangouts (or Google Talk) will now need to download the stand-alone Google Hangouts iOS app from the app store.
